Muse: When looking for a title to read in a genre as wide as shoujo manga, it’s hard to know where to start.

Helen: Especially when a lot of the titles look so similar!

Muse: And despite stereotypes, not all shoujo manga is all sparkles and “boy meets girl” stories either. However, with the wide amount of titles available, some true gems get swept under the rug or have started to fade from memory.

Helen: So this is where we come in: The two of us have loved shoujo for a long time and we’re a little sad that we don’t see as much discussion about the series we used to love, both the “boy meets girl” romances and many other kinds of stories. So, let’s tell people about them!

Muse: During the summer, we’ll be sharing those titles in this column, which we’re calling Shoujo You Should Know!

Helen: And since this is going to be a collaborative project, we’re going to have two types of reviews: joint reviews between the both of us for series that are near and dear to both of us, and then separate reviews for some others. It’ll be enough for a full summer of shoujo because who DOESN’T want to sit in air conditioning and read manga all summer?

Muse: We’re hoping that through this column you will discover not only series that you’re never read before but will also remember some old favorites.
